Medical Billing Specialist
Title Medical Billing Specialist Job Category Healthcare City Dallas, State TX Location Dallas,TX Zip Code 75230 Salary Open Job Type Not Specified Req Education High School/(GED) Date Posted 9/10/2009 Description
Medical Biller Temp-to-hire $11.00 - $12.00/hour Bridgeport, TX Job Duties * Responsible for collecting, posting and managing account payments. * Responsible for submitting claims and following up with insurance companies. * Prepares and submits clean claims to various insurance companies either electronically or by paper. * Answers questions from patients, clerical staff and insurance companies. * Identifies and resolves patient billing complaints. * Prepares, reviews and sends patient statements * Evaluates patientâ?Ts financial status and establishes budget payment plans. * Follows and reports status of delinquent accounts. * Reviews accounts for possible assignment and makes recommendations to the Billing Supervisor, also prepares information for the collection agency. * Performs daily backups on office computer system * Performs various collection actions including contacting patients by phone, correcting and resubmitting claims to third party payers. * Processes payments from insurance companies and prepares a daily deposit. * Conducts self in accordance with HPAâ?Ts employee manual. * Maintains strictest confidentiality; adheres to all HIPAA guidelines/regulations. Education * High School Diploma * Medical Billing Certificate preferred Skills/Experience * Knowledge of medical billing/collection practices. * 1 year of hands on experience with billing in a hospital * CDM experience * Knowledge of computer programs. * Knowledge of business office procedures. * Knowledge of basic medical coding and third-party operating procedures and practices. * Ability to operate a computer and basic office equipment. * Ability to operate a multi-line telephone system. * Skill in answering a telephone in a pleasant and helpful manner. * Ability to read, understand and follow oral and written instructions. *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with patients, employees and the public. * Must be well organized and detail-oriented.
